随着区块链技术的迅猛发展,数字货币的广泛应用,私钥钱包成为了每个数字货币用户必备的安全工具。私钥钱包可以有效保护用户的数字资产,让用户拥有对其资产的独立控制权。在这篇文章中,我们将深入探讨私钥钱包的工作原理、开发过程、安全性以及相关的热点问题。

私钥钱包的基本概念

私钥钱包通常指的是由用户自己管理私钥的数字钱包,这种钱包与第三方服务相对立,用户对私钥的完全掌握旨在提供最大的安全性与隐私保护。在区块链生态中,每一个用户都能拥有一个唯一的私钥,作为其数字资产的授权凭证。

在传统的银行体系中,银行负责保管用户的资金与密码;然而在区块链体系中,用户需对其资金具有绝对的控制权。区块链私钥钱包的作用不仅在于存储数字货币,更多的是提供一种去中心化的资产管理方式。

私钥钱包的工作原理

区块链开发私钥钱包:深入了解安全性与实用性

私钥钱包的工作原理相对复杂。首先,用户会生成一对密钥:公钥和私钥。其中,公钥是可以公开分享的,用户可以使用公钥来接收交易。而私钥则需谨慎保管,因为任何人一旦获得私钥,就可以对该公钥下的资产进行支配。

当用户需要进行交易时,交易信息会通过私钥进行数字签名,这种签名保证了交易的真实性和不可篡改性。交易在区块链上被广播后,矿工会对其进行验证,确保该私钥拥有者确实发起了此次交易。这些复杂的加密技术为区块链提供了一个安全、透明的操作环境。

私钥钱包的开发过程

开发一个私钥钱包需要考虑多个方面,包括但不限于用户界面设计、安全性、支持的区块链种类以及钱包的功能性。以下是开发过程中的几个关键步骤:

1. **需求分析**:确定目标用户群体,分析他们的需求和使用习惯,这是设计相应功能的基础。

2. **选择合适的区块链技术**:根据需求选择支持的区块链,可以是以太坊、比特币等。不同的区块链可能会影响钱包的数据结构和交易方式。

3. **设计用户界面**:用户友好的界面设计将直接影响用户的体验。确保界面简洁、易于导航,并能快速引导用户进行各种交易。

4. **构建核心功能**:实现资产存储、发送、接收、历史记录查询等基本功能。在实现这些功能时,需重点关注安全和隐私。

5. **安全性审核和测试**:安全性是钱包开发的重心之一。进行全面的安全性测试,包括漏洞扫描、渗透测试等,确保用户数字资产的安全。

6. **上线和市场推广**:最后将钱包发布于相应平台,并通过合适的市场策略吸引用户使用。

私钥钱包的安全性

区块链开发私钥钱包:深入了解安全性与实用性

私钥钱包的安全性,是用户最为关注的问题之一。由于私钥是所有交易的基础,其安全性直接关系到用户资产的安全。以下是一些保障私钥钱包安全的要素:

1. **私钥存储方式**:不同钱包的私钥存储方式不同,热钱包通常意味着连接互联网,安全性相对较低;而冷钱包,例如硬件钱包,尽量不与互联网连接,更加安全。

2. **多重签名机制**:使用多重签名可以显著提高安全性,只有在多个私钥(通常是由多个用户控制)进行批准后,交易才能有效。

3. **定期更新与安全审核**:确保软件版本及时更新,并进行定期的安全审计,可以有效减少被攻击的风险。

4. **用户教育**:对用户进行安全知识的普及,包括如何保管私钥、如何识别钓鱼网站等,将大大降低因用户疏忽造成的损失。

私钥钱包的应用实例

私钥钱包的应用范围广泛,涵盖了多个领域,以下是几个显著的实例:

1. **数字货币交易**:许多数字货币用户使用私钥钱包进行日常的买卖交易,借助于其私钥保护,用户可以自由地控制他们的资金。

2. **去中心化金融(DeFi)**:在DeFi生态中,私钥钱包扮演着至关重要的角色。用户通过私钥进行智能合约的交互,如流动性池、借贷平台等。

3. **NFT市场**:用户在购买和交易NFT时,也需要私钥钱包来确保对数字资产的完整控制。

常见问题解答

私钥钱包和热钱包、冷钱包有什么区别?

私钥钱包通常是指用户自己管理私钥的数字钱包,而热钱包和冷钱包是私钥钱包的具体存储方式。在热钱包中,私钥被存储在不断连接互联网的设备上,虽然方便,但相对安全性较低;冷钱包则是将私钥存储在不联网的环境中,安全性更高,但在使用时不方便。

在选择钱包时,用户需根据自身的交易频率和安全需求做出合理选择。如果用户频繁进行交易,可以选择热钱包,但应强化安全措施;如果用户希望长期保管资产,冷钱包是更好的选择。

如何生成和安全管理私钥?

生成私钥的方式有很多,通常推荐使用行业标准的随机数生成器,确保私钥的复杂性,避免简单密码被破解。用户可以选择在本地生成私钥,而非通过在线服务,这样可以避免潜在的网络攻击。

在安全管理私钥时,可以采取以下措施:使用硬件钱包进行离线存储、定期备份和分散存储私钥、使用助记词恢复私钥、熟悉钓鱼攻击的识别等。综合多种措施,可以显著提高私钥的安全性。

私钥丢失或被盗用怎么办?

一旦私钥丢失,用户将无法访问其钱包中的数字资产,这也是私钥钱包的一个重大缺陷。因此,备份私钥是十分重要的,可以将私钥以纸质形式、安全的电子方式存储,甚至保留多份备份。如果私钥被盗取,用户可能需要寻求专业的安全团队进行处理,虽然成功率不高,但仍可尝试通过链上活动追踪盗贼。

如何防范私钥钱包的安全风险?

防范私钥钱包的安全风险主要包括:定期更新软件、保持操作系统和应用程序的安全、使用双因素认证、警惕网络钓鱼邮件、定期检查钱包的交易记录、使用强密码等。通过多重保障措施,用户可以显著降低安全风险。

私钥钱包未来的发展趋势是什么?

随着区块链技术的不断革新和数字货币的快速扩张,私钥钱包的未来发展有几个方向:首先,用户体验会更加友好,二是安全性措施会越来越严密,采用多种高科技手段保护用户资产,例如生物识别技术,将私钥与用户身份绑定。最后,随着DeFi和Web3的兴起,更多的应用场景将出现,私钥钱包的需求会持续增长。

综上所述,私钥钱包在区块链开发中扮演着重要角色,其安全性和实用性不可小觑。希望这篇文章能为您提供更深入的了解,帮助您在数字货币的世界中实现更好的资产管理与保护。